What Is Adult ADHD?
Adult ADHD is characterized by relentless patterns of inattention, hyperactivity, and impulsivity. These symptoms can manifest differently in adults than children, often causing considerable challenges in different elements of life, such as work, relationships, and emotional wellness.
Common Symptoms of Adult ADHD
Inattention
Difficulty sustaining attention in jobs,Frequent lapse of memory,Trouble arranging jobs and activities,Losing things required for tasks,Easily distracted by extraneous stimuli.
Hyperactivity and Impulsivity
Uneasyness or difficulty remaining still,Fidgeting with hands or feet,Speaking exceedingly or disrupting others,Difficulty waiting for one's turn.
Recognizing these symptoms is essential for determining possible ADHD. However, it requires a professional assessment for an official diagnosis.
Who Should Get Tested for ADHD?
Testing for adult ADHD is recommended for people experiencing considerable challenges in day-to-day working or persistent symptoms that impact their lifestyle. Typical situations that may warrant an ADHD test consist of:
Struggling to fulfill deadlines at work or home,Chronic poor organization,Persistent relationship problems,History of underachievement or frequent task changes,Co-existing psychological health conditions like stress and anxiety or anxiety.The ADHD Testing Process
Testing for adult ADHD typically involves multiple actions that culminate in a comprehensive assessment. Below are the main parts:
1. Initial Consultation
Throughout this stage, the healthcare expert, frequently a psychologist or psychiatrist, will:
Review medical history,Discuss symptoms you're experiencing,Assess any family history of ADHD or associated conditions.2. Medical Interviews
The expert might conduct a structured interview to dig much deeper into your experiences. They might ask concerns like:
When did you initially see your symptoms?How do your symptoms impact your every day life?Have you ever experienced symptoms in childhood?3. Standardized Questionnaires
You will more than likely be asked to fill out surveys that are specifically created to assess ADHD symptoms. Common tools consist of:
Adult ADHD Self-Report Scale (ASRS),Conners Adult ADHD Rating Scales,Barkley Adult ADHD Rating Scale.4. Behavioral Assessment
Healthcare companies may also evaluate your habits in numerous settings. This may consist of feedback from member of the family, partners, or colleagues through score scales, which can highlight how symptoms manifest in various environments.
5. Eliminate Other Conditions
Before a medical diagnosis is made, other potential causes of the symptoms will need to be dismissed, as many psychological health conditions share symptoms with ADHD.
6. Diagnosis Discussion
Once assessments are total, the health care professional will talk about the findings with you, detailing whether the requirements for Adult ADHD are satisfied and detailing possible next steps.

Frequently Asked Questions About Adult ADHD TestingQ1: How long does the testing procedure take?
The entire assessment procedure can cause a diagnosis, frequently taking a couple of hours to numerous sessions, depending on the complexity of the case.
Q2: Will I need to take medication after testing?
Not always. It depends upon private preferences and the seriousness of symptoms. Some people successfully manage their symptoms through way of life modifications and therapy alone.
Q3: Can ADHD symptoms change with time?
Yes, symptoms can progress throughout a person's life. While inattention might have been more noticable in youth, adults might experience more significant impulsivity and emotional guideline issues.
Q4: Is adult ADHD a lifelong condition?
While ADHD is generally a lifelong condition, lots of adults find reliable coping methods and treatments that assist them lead satisfying lives.
Q5: Will insurance coverage cover ADHD testing?
Numerous insurance coverage prepares cover ADHD evaluations and treatments, but it varies by company. It's vital to consult your insurer for specific coverage details.
